License and Security
Before we get to the good stuff, it’s important to establish the credentials of the casino.
Bitstarz is operated by Dama N.V, a company incorporated in Curaçao (company no. 152125), and has a Curaçao Gaming Control Board license (no. OGL/2023/174/0082). The license was granted on 23/08/2024 and was active at the time of writing.
The site connection is secure and the security certificate is valid
Welcome Bonus
In typical big crypto casino style, BitStarz offers what seems, at first glance at least, to be an extremely generous sign-up bonus for new players. Specifically, it’s €500 or 5 BTC + 180 Free Spins. Now, at the time of writing, 5 BTC was worth around €325,000 – quite a sum!
Specifically, the BitStarzs Welcome Package breaks down as follows:
1st Deposit – 100% up to €100 or 1 BTC + 180 Free Spins (20 instant free spins + 160 credited in batches of 20 per day). Minimum deposit of €20 EUR to get the free spins.
2nd Deposit – 50% up to €100 or 1 BTC
3rd Deposit – 50% up to €200 or 2 BTC
4th Deposit – 100% up to €100 or 1BTC
Of course, the BitStarz welcome offer is designed to get players to deposit in crypto, which makes sense for a crypto casino. But, that’s quite a disparity between fiat and crypto, so this deal needs unpacking. Indeed, 5 BTC seems like a ridiculously high amount. Is it even realistically possible to get such a high-value bonus?
BitStarz Welcome Bonus Dissected
So, to get the 5 BTC bonus, you’ll have to deposit 8 BTC, which at the time of writing would be €520,000 (EUR) worth of Bitcoin. From this point on, it should be obvious that virtually no one is ever going to get a bonus worth anywhere close to 5 BTC from this offer.
And, we haven’t even looked at the wagering requirements yet. Disappointingly, these aren’t even mentioned in any of the initial promotional material – you have to open the Bonus Terms & Conditions to find them. It turns out that the “Wagering Requirements for Free and Registration bonuses are forty (40) times the Bonus sum awarded to you”. And, importantly, each part of the bonus is only valid for 7 days – so you’ll need to be quick.
Additionally, to qualify for the free spins element of the BitStarz welcome package, you’ll need to wager your deposit 1x within 24 hours of making it. Plus, any winnings from those free spins will also be subject to a 40x wagering requirement. Free Spins must also be used within 1 day of them being credited or they will expire.
Another important thing to consider is game weighting when it comes to wagering requirements contributions. Specifically, slots (except for those listed in point 3.6 of the Bonus Terms & Conditions) contribute 100%, while table games, video poker games, Jogo do Bicho, live games, and BitStarz Originals (excluding the slot game) only contribute 5%.
BitStarz Welcome Bonus Verdict
In fairness, 40x wagering requirements aren’t anything out of the ordinary, but in this case, it renders the potential 5 BTC bonus absurd. Even if you were a rich crypto bro who managed to deposit enough to get the full 5 BTC bonus from the BitStarz welcome package, you’d still need to wager €13 million worth of Bitcoin (based on the prices at the time of writing) to meet requirements!
Of course, given Bitcoin’s volatility, these figures could change significantly, very quickly, either up or down. But, you get the point. BitStarz’s welcome package is, technically speaking, real, but it may as well not be. In fact, it’s all a bit silly. Yep. That’s pretty much my verdict. It’s one of those crypto casino bonuses that seems huge but isn’t even remotely realistic.
However, once you’ve figured this out, it’s still possible to use the welcome offer to your advantage. Just make sure you do the maths first and deposit a rational amount that will enable you to meet the wagering requirements.

Payments
Unlike some pure crypto casinos, such as Shuffle, BitStarz supports a range of cryptocurrencies and fiat payment methods.

Crypto Deposits & Withdrawals:












To deposit using crypto, just select “Deposit” (the green tab at the top right of the screen). Then select a cryptocurrency and enter how much you’d like to transfer. Then click the “Play with XXX” tab. You’ll then be provided with a Private Deposit Address (as both a QR code and a regular address). Send the crypto from your wallet to this address, then click the green tab to confirm you’ve made the transfer.

Withdrawing is just as simple. Open your balance, select “Withdraw”, select your crypto and enter how much you’d like to withdraw. Paste in your destination wallet address (make sure the address you’re withdrawing to supports the specific crypto you’re using). The withdrawal fee will be displayed before you confirm the transaction.
CoinBets.com Tip: Always double-check crypto wallet addresses after pasting them – you don’t want to fall victim to ‘PasteJacking’. This is when hackers exploit the copy-paste function to change wallet addresses to steal funds.

Game Selection
At the time of writing BitStarz offered over 6,000 casino games from almost 70 game studios – which puts it in the top-tier of crypto casinos in terms of sheer choice.

In common with virtually all crypto casinos, most of the games available at BitStarz are slots of various themes and types. As you’d expect, you’ll find online slots from all the big-name providers like NetEnt, Relax Gaming, NoLimit City, and Novomatic. So, whether you’re in the mood for edgy games like Skate or Die and Punk Rocker, hits like Gonzo’s Quest and Starburst, or all-time classics like Book of Ra and Lucky Lady’s Charm Deluxe, BitStarz has you covered.

With so many slot games on offer, browsing them effectively requires filters. By default, your homepage will only have a few different game categories displayed, so you’ll probably want to customize things a little. And, while this is easy enough, I can imagine many players probably overlook it. So, click the “Settings” cog icon to the right of the “Game Studios” tab. This will now let you add categories like Megaways, Buy Bonus Games, “Book of” Games, etc.
Speaking of Megways, there are lots available, but also some non-Megaways slots seem to be miscategorized. Still, if you love your paylines, you’re not likely to get bored here. Titles available include 1 Million Megaways BC, Rainbow Jackpots Megaways, Fire Works Megaways, Rasputin Megaways, and dozens more.
One category where BitStarz does disappoint a little is jackpot slots. There is a jackpot category with a few dozen jackpot games, like DaVinci Diamonds Jackpot, Sirens Cove Jackpot, and Rocket Chimp Jackpot, but you won’t find anything in the league of the record-breaking Mega Moolah series.

BitStarz offers around 100 live dealer games, which puts it ahead of rivals like Shuffle, but considerably behind the likes of Gamdom (which has more than 500 live titles available). Surprisingly, all the live games are from one provider – but, that provider is Evolution, which is widely regarded as the industry leader. Several varieties of blackjack, roulette, baccarat, craps, sic bo, and poker are available, including VIP European Roulette, Lightning Roulette, Speed Baccarat, Speed Blackjack, Three Card Poker, and Caribbean Stud Poker.
A modest selection of eleven live game shows are also available to play – which can be accessed via their own dedicated category and the live casino section. Titles include Stock Market Live, Cash or Crash Live, Crazy Time, and Dream Catcher.

With just over 40 options available, the BitStarz table games and video poker selection isn’t the biggest, but it will be more than enough for most players. You’ll find the usual variety of blackjack, roulette, baccarat, and poker. Again though, the categorization seems a little bit messy here – with a few live table games appearing in this category, but not the live casino category (for example, games live from the Hippodrome Casino and Casino Malta).

There’s no bingo category at BitStarz, and a search turned up just two games; Wild Bingo and Just A Bingo!
As one of the oldest online crypto casinos, I was expecting the provably fair game selection at BitStarz to be pretty good, and I was right. Whereas most crypto casinos will have a handful of provably fair games, there are over 40 on offer here – 8 BitStarz Originals, 10 from Evoplay, and 24 from BGaming.
The BitStarz Originals games are similar to the in-house ranges from most crypto casinos, with titles like Plinko, Mines, Dice, Black Jack, Slot, Crash, and Wheel. However, the blockchain-based games from BGaming and Evoplay, like Book of Pyramids, Fantasy Park, West Town, Penalty Shoot-Out, and Red Queen do add some much-appreciated variety.

Unusually for a large crypto gambling site, BitStarz doesn’t currently offer sports betting.
It seems like the team at BitStarz likes to make things overly complicated wherever possible, and this is certainly true when it comes to promotions. Of course, I’ve already explained the convoluted welcome package, but let’s take a look at some of the regular promotions.
Jackpotz Mania – Your chance to win one of the three BitStarz Jackpots (Mega, Minor, JPM Race). It involves logging in every day and trying to hit certain win targets on specified games. To say this is overly complicated is a major understatement, and to explain it all would make this review about six times longer… instead, I’ll just show you some screenshots and you can judge for yourself. My gut feeling is that this is overly complicated quite deliberately, so that people are driven to spend more without really knowing what’s going on.


Level Up Adventure – A seasonal promotion (at the time of writing, Halloween) with very nice graphics giving away $50K in individual prizes, including a $20K cash prize. It’s a blatant spend-to-progress promo – you’ll advance through the 41 levels as you wager more at the casino.
Slot Wars – A simple slot tournament giving away €5,000 plus 5,000 Free Spins each week. The first prize is €1,500 cash.
Table Wars – Another simple tournament, but this time for table games, with a €10,000 weekly prize pool.

As to be expected, BitStarz offers real-time player support via live chat – I was put in touch with a “Support Hero” named Dave. There’s always a Dave. Everything seemed okay, though it took a while before I was convinced it was a person and not a bot I was chatting with.
One thing I’ve got to point out is after a chat it suggests sending crypto to tip the support staff. Erm… am I missing something here? I’m pretty sure this is doing more damage than good to BitStarz. Since when have support staff expected tips? And, if they need them, it strongly hints that BitStarz isn’t paying their team enough.
Anyway, if you want to avoid getting wound up by the cheeky tip thing, you can reach out to the team via Telegram or email them directly at: support [at] bitstarz [dot] com.

When it comes to design, BitStarz looks the same as a bunch of other crypto casinos, like Stake.com and BC.Game. There’s nothing creative or original about it, but it looks nice enough. Navigation seemed okay at first, but after a while, I got quite frustrated with it. Certain categories and filters are hard to find, games are miscategorized, and most annoying of all, terms and conditions are seemingly hidden – or at least, nowhere near as prominent as they should be.

Unfortunately, there are no BitStarz mobile apps available for either Android or iOS devices. In fairness, this isn’t a shock, as neither Google Play nor the App Store allow crypto casino apps. However, you can still enjoy BitStarz on your smartphone because it has been optimized to run smoothly on all popular mobile browsers.

Verdict
Personally, I like BitStarz on many levels. The choice of games is fantastic, with all the big-name providers represented, but also plenty of smaller studios like Prospect Gaming, AdLunam, Clawbuster and Slotopia – which adds lots of depth and gives you plenty to explore. The choice of provably fair games, BitStarz originals and exclusives is also impressive. And, while it’s not exactly pushing the bounds of creativity, the design of the site itself is perfectly acceptable.
But, there’s a but. And, it’s a big but (I know you’re singing a certain song in your head now); the promotional offers are a bit, well “iffy”. Sure, they look good at first glance, but the welcome bonus is ridiculous – literally, the “5 BTC” thing is just there to dazzle people – it’s entirely unrealistic. And, even more annoyingly, the terms and conditions aren’t displayed prominently. Considering how much experience BitStarz has under its belt, it’s hard to believe this isn’t deliberate. Additionally, most of the regular promos take the form of tournaments designed to pressure players into wagering as much as possible. Not cool.
Taking a step back and looking at the overall picture painted by user feedback, it seems the prevailing view among players is quite similar to my own. BitStarz is fundamentally a solid crypto casino offering a good range of games, but needs to make its bonuses and offers more transparent – and possibly hire some more support staff and streamline verification procedures.
So, the bottom line is, that BitStarz has a great product in terms of games, but you should approach all bonuses, promotions, and tournaments with an abundance of caution. Don’t expect terms and conditions to be laid out in front of you, and don’t expect them to be particularly clearly written. Always look for that little ‘i’ button and click on it for more info. In common with some other crypto casinos, like BC.Game and Stake, BitStarz can be plenty of fun and very rewarding, but only if you keep your wits about you. Keep things in perspective, stick to your budget, and don’t go chasing the ridiculously big bonuses if you’re not going to be able to easily afford to meet wagering.
